The History and Evolution of Onomichi Dango Masayoshi Ramen Original

The Birthplace: Onomichi’s Culinary Legacy

Onomichi, a charming port city in Hiroshima Prefecture, is famous for its picturesque landscapes, historic temples, and rich culinary traditions. The city’s strategic location near the Seto Inland Sea has influenced its food culture, bringing fresh seafood and traditional Japanese flavors together.

Ramen in Onomichi has a long history, dating back to the early 20th century when local vendors began serving a distinct soy sauce-based ramen with a unique broth. Over the years, chefs refined their techniques, eventually giving rise to Onomichi Dango Masayoshi Ramen Original, a dish that has become synonymous with the city’s gastronomic identity.

The Unique Flavor Profile of Onomichi Dango Masayoshi Ramen Original

The Broth: A Harmonious Blend of Umami

Any ramen dish’s broth isBrothessence, and Original Onomichi Dango Masayoshi Ramen is no different. This ramen is slow-cooked using chicken, hog bones, and seafood extracts from local sources, and it has a thick, umami-flavored soy sauce foundation. Together, these components provide a flavorful broth that is both delicate and strong.

The Noodles: Crafted to Perfection

The noodles used in Onomichi Dango Masayoshi Ramen Original are another significant aspect that adds to its distinctiveness. Unlike conventional ramen noodles, they are somewhat thinner, with a firm but chewy texture that suits the broth niBroth Made from high-quality wheat, they are created to absorb the rich aromas of the broth whBrothreserving their unique bite.

The Toppings: A Perfectly Balanced Combination

Toppings play a crucial role in enhancing the overall experience of Original Onomichi Dango Masayoshi Ramen. Some of the signature toppings include:

  • Chashu (Braised Pork Belly): Slow-cooked to achieve a melt-in-the-mouth texture, adding a savory depth to the dish.
  • Menma (Bamboo Shoots): Provides a slight crunch, balancing out the rich broth.
  • GBrothOnions: A fresh, mild contrast to the strong umami flavors.
  • Dango Masayoshi: A special dango-style topping that sets this ramen apart, offering a slightly sweet and chewy texture that complements the dish beautifully.
  • Nori (Seaweed): Enhances the flavor profile with its subtle oceanic essence.
